How to Cancel Microsoft 365
Cancel Microsoft 365 without losing your files. OneDrive storage drops to 5GB — here's how to prepare.
Cancellation friction
Cancellation is hidden under multiple menus, and you risk losing OneDrive storage immediately.
Refund policy
Prorated refund available within 30 days for annual subscriptions.
Step-by-step instructions
- Step 1
Go to account.microsoft.com and sign in.
- Step 2
Click "Services & subscriptions" in the top navigation.
- Step 3
Find Microsoft 365 → click "Manage".
- Step 4
Click "Cancel" under the subscription details.
- Step 5
Follow the prompts. Microsoft may offer a discount — skip if you want to cancel.
💡 If you have more than 5GB in OneDrive, download your files first.
- Step 6
Confirm cancellation. You'll get a confirmation email.
Common issues
“What happens to my Office apps (Word, Excel, PowerPoint)?”
Apps switch to "read-only" mode after cancellation. You can view but not edit documents. Microsoft 365 on the web (Office.com) remains free with limited features.
“What happens to OneDrive storage?”
Your storage drops to the free 5GB limit. If you have more data, you have 30 days to download or delete files before Microsoft restricts access.
“Can I get a refund?”
Yes, for annual subscriptions cancelled within 30 days of purchase or renewal. Monthly subscriptions are not refunded. Contact Microsoft support for annual refunds.
